Wajszczuk, M.D. W hen you need a doctor some people seek the recommendation of a family member or friends. However, we welcome you to contact Sinai Hospital's physician referral service for a physi- cian who meets your needs or those of your fam- ily. The service refers callers to more than 500 members of Sinai's active medical staff in spe- cialties from obstetrics/gynecology to cardiology to orthopedic surgery to family practice. When you call 1-800-248-3627, you will be asked to identify which type of physician you need (Sinai's operators can help you do this), a preferred office location and your health insurance. Feel free to discuss special requests such as a male or female physician or one who speaks a particu- lar foreign language. We will make every attempt to refer you directly to the type of physician you've requested to make an appointment at that time. After calling Sinai's physician referral service, you will receive in the mail additional informa- tion on the physicians including their education- al and training background, specialties and subspecialties and office hours. Outer Drive Detroit, MI 48235 T o keep you up-to-date on the latest medical advancements at Sinai and across the country, the Sinai Speakers Bu- reau links our healthcare professionals with civic, community, professional and religious organizations through-out metro- politan Detroit to discuss timely medical issues that concern you most. Our expert stafFof speakers includes physicians, nurs- es, therapists and other medical special- ists who are eager to share their expertise with you. Whether your group includes 20 or 200 people, the Sinai Speakers Bureau has something for everyone! From starting an exercise program for a healthy heart, to presentations on arthritis and stress man- agement, our program is tailor-made just for you In addition, Sinai offers a special pro- gram created just for women. Our Vital Woman program is a unique way for women to get together in small groups (15 maximum) to learn about the latest de- velopments in women's healthcare and to discuss women's health issues. Our speak- ers address such issues as birth control, menopause, premenstrual syndrome, maintaining good health during pregnan- cy and breast health, just to name a few.
